Overview Ondacod 2mg Syrup

PediaNausea 2mg Syrup is a pediatric medication used to alleviate nausea and vomiting. Its primary application is managing nausea and vomiting related to surgery, chemotherapy, radiotherapy, and gastrointestinal infections. It's also effective in countering emetic side effects from analgesics. Administration of PediaNausea 2mg Syrup can occur before or after meals. For chemotherapy-induced vomiting, administer 30 minutes prior to treatment. For radiotherapy, administer 1-2 hours beforehand, and 1 hour before surgery to prevent post-operative vomiting. If your child vomits the medication within 30 minutes, soothe your child and re-administer the dose. Avoid doubling the dose if it's near the scheduled time for the next dose. PediaNausea 2mg Syrup may cause transient side effects such as headache, constipation, diarrhea, and tiredness. These usually resolve as your child's body adjusts. If these persist or worsen, contact your physician immediately. Disclose all medications your child is taking, including pain relievers, antibiotics, and antidepressants. Also, report any pre-existing liver or kidney conditions, gastrointestinal obstructions, heart problems, or drug/food allergies. This information is crucial for appropriate dosage and comprehensive treatment planning.

How to use Ondacod 2mg Syrup:

Administer this medication according to your physician's prescribed dosage and schedule. Always consult the product label for instructions prior to consumption. Use a measuring device for accurate dosing and ingest orally. Ensure thorough shaking before each use. Ondacod 2mg Syrup can be ingested with or without food; however, consistent timing is recommended.

How Ondacod 2mg Syrup works:

Before procedures like radiotherapy, chemotherapy, abdominal surgery, or other major operations, dying cells release serotonin into the bloodstream. This serotonin triggers the body's vomiting reflex in children. Administering Ondacod 2mg Syrup beforehand counteracts serotonin's action on the brain's emetic centers, thus preventing nausea and vomiting.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holCAUTION

Using Ondacod 2mg Syrup with alcohol requires careful consideration. Seek medical advice before combining them.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Data on the use of Ondacod 2mg Syrup in pregnancy is lacking. Seek medical advice from your physician.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Data on the safety of Ondacod 2mg Syrup for breastfeeding mothers is lacking. Seek medical advice from your physician.

DrivingDriving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The effect of Ondacod 2mg Syrup on driving ability is undetermined. Refrain from driving if any symptoms impair your concentration or reflexes.

KidneyKid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ED

For patients with kidney impairment, Ondacod 2mg Syrup presents no safety concerns. Dosage modification for Ondacod 2mg Syrup is unnecessary.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should use Ondacod 2mg Syrup cautiously. Dosage modification of Ondacod 2mg Syrup may be necessary; physician consultation is recommended.

What if you forget to take Ondacod 2mg Syrup :

Remain calm. Administer the forgotten dose immediately upon recollection. Nevertheless, omit the missed dose if the next scheduled dose is imminent. Avoid doubling the dose; adhere to the recommended medication schedule.

FAQs on Ondacod 2mg Syrup

Ondacod 2mg Syrup helps prevent post-surgical or post-chemotherapy/radiotherapy vomiting in children. Doctors may also prescribe it to treat vomiting from stomach ailments, typically for a short course. Always follow the prescribed dosage for optimal effectiveness.
Accidental overdose of Ondacod 2mg Syrup is unlikely to be harmful, but contact your child's doctor immediately if it occurs. Excessive intake may cause serious side effects, including drowsiness, agitation, rapid heart rate, high blood pressure, flushing, dilated pupils, sweating, muscle spasms, involuntary eye movements, hyperreflexia, and seizures (serotonin syndrome). Seek immediate medical attention if any of these occur.
Store Ondacod 2mg Syrup at room temperature, in a dry place, protected from heat and light. Keep it out of children's reach and sight to prevent accidental ingestion.
Combining Ondacod 2mg Syrup with antidepressants, apomorphine, migraine medications, painkillers, heart medications, or antibiotics like linezolid is generally not recommended. Always consult your child's doctor before administering Ondacod 2mg Syrup; provide a complete medical history and follow their instructions carefully.
Seek immediate medical attention for your child if they exhibit serotonin syndrome symptoms such as: rapid or irregular heartbeat, greenish vomit, constipation, pale skin and eyes, dark urine, agitation, and sleeplessness.
Don't give Ondacod 2mg Syrup with antidepressants or migraine medications; this combination can cause serotonin syndrome. Always consult your child's doctor before administering any medication.
